The Cost of Exclusivity

Breaking down the value of a big island vacation house for a large group reveals advantages that never appear on a hotel rate sheet. Consider what a private estate absorbs that a resort charges separately:

  • No resort fees layered onto each room, per night, per person
  • Private parking for the group, without valet charges or daily garage rates
  • Full laundry access on-site, eliminating the quiet indignity of hotel laundry pricing
  • A gourmet kitchen that replaces three meals a day of restaurant spending with the pleasure of cooking together
  • Exclusive amenity access, where the pool, gym, and game room belong entirely to your group

Planning Your 2026 Big Island Escape: Logistics for 10 or More

Logistics are where group trips quietly fall apart. Not at the beach. Not over dinner. In the weeks before departure, when nobody has taken ownership of the decisions that actually determine whether the trip flows or fractures. Getting ahead of that friction is the difference between a gathering people remember warmly and one they quietly agree never to repeat.

Start with a single group lead. One person with the authority to make final calls on accommodation, transport, and the shared itinerary. This isn’t about hierarchy; it’s about momentum. Group decisions made by committee tend to stall, and the best properties book out quickly ahead of peak season. Designate someone, give them a clear mandate, and let them move.

From there, the checklist is straightforward:

  • Confirm the bedding configuration first. A property that comfortably sleeps 16 guests with 8 king size beds removes the single greatest source of pre-trip anxiety for large groups. Every adult arrives to a sleeping arrangement that doesn’t require negotiation.
  • Coordinate transport before you land. The Big Island is not a walkable destination. Two large SUVs or a private van keeps the group mobile without the chaos of coordinating multiple rideshares across unfamiliar roads. Arrange this before you leave home.
  • Pre-stock the kitchen. The first-day grocery scramble, sixteen people, an unfamiliar store, and competing preferences, is one of the most reliably exhausting experiences in group travel. Place a grocery order for delivery before arrival. Breakfast ingredients, staples, and snacks waiting in a fully equipped kitchen change the entire tone of day one.
  • Book group excursions early. Private boat charters, snorkeling tours, and guided lava field walks fill quickly in 2026’s peak season. Secure these in the first week of planning, not the first week of the trip.

How do I ensure a private estate has enough king size beds for my group of 16?

Ask the question directly and confirm it in writing before you book. The specific phrase to look for is “8 king size beds” rather than a room count, which tells you far less about the actual sleeping experience. A property listing that emphasizes bedroom numbers without specifying bed types often signals a configuration built for visual appeal rather than genuine group comfort. Prioritize bedding configuration over room count every time.

How far in advance should I book a Hawaii family vacation house for 10+ for 2026?

For peak 2026 travel dates, including summer and the winter holiday window, the most sought-after private estates on the Kohala Coast begin filling well ahead of the season. Booking six to twelve months in advance is a reasonable baseline for a group of ten or more, both to secure availability and to allow enough lead time to coordinate transport, pre-stock the kitchen, and arrange group excursions before the best options close. Waiting until the year of travel significantly narrows your choices at the quality level this kind of gathering deserves.
